Among the various posts is links to at least two versions of articles attributed to Ed Harris about how to make and store Ed's Red.

The batches that I made up have still not melted through the containers shown in that thread - so far, so good - each are perhaps still 50% or more full. From what I saw mixing acetone with ATF (that is 1/2 of Ed's Red), it would not really mix - sitting on work bench in clear pop bottle, over several days, would see the ATF go down and Acetone go up - so had to be shaken vigorously before using it - at that point looks sort of "pink" - like Milk of Magnesia. I can not see into the Ed's Red with Acetone container - so I have been keeping it capped and shake it again before using it.

steel wool removes the lead or plastic deposits faster ....

But the question is .... will steel wool "damage" the barrel?

Will steel wool create a "polishing pattern" inside the barrel and that will just trap more lead or plastic fouling?

0000 steel wool will not harm the bore in any way.

If you were to rub it on the bluing it would take hours of rubbing before you would see any deterioration in the bluing.
